以太坊区块更新时间:历史背景与现状分析
目录导读
本文旨在详细介绍以太坊区块更新时间的历史背景及其当前状态,并探讨可能影响该时间的因素以及相应的优化方法。
以太坊区块更新时间的历史背景
在区块链技术中,以太坊以其独特的特性成为全球最大的去中心化平台,区块更新时间是衡量系统性能的重要指标,随着以太坊网络的发展,用户对交易处理速度和安全性提出了更高的要求,这一需求促使了社区对区块更新时间的关注和研究。
历史演变
- 早期发展阶段:最初,以太坊区块更新时间为大约每15秒。
- 提高效率:为了满足日益增长的交易量需求,社区成员提出了一系列改进方案,包括调整区块大小和引入PoS共识算法。
- 当前标准:以太坊的区块平均更新时间为约15分钟(具体取决于网络负载情况)。
当前以太坊区块更新频率
以太坊网络的区块更新频率是一个关键参数,它直接关系到用户的体验和系统的稳定性。
系统表现
- 高并发场景:当网络流量激增时,如大型活动或重大事件期间,区块更新时间可能会显著缩短,甚至达到几秒钟。
- 低负载时期:在网络负载较低的情况下,区块更新时间可以延长至超过一小时。
影响区块更新时间的因素
以下因素会影响区块更新时间:
区块容量
- 更小的区块大小允许更快的确认时间,但会增加矿工的工作量。
- 较大的区块容量虽然提高了吞吐量,但也增加了计算难度。
智能合约执行延迟
- 如果智能合约执行过程中出现错误或延迟,会导致整个区块更新过程变慢。
集群规模与分布
- 各个节点之间的通信延迟和链上事务的数量直接影响区块更新时间。
- 分布式共识算法的选择也会影响区块的确认速度。
优化区块更新时间的方法
通过实施以下策略,可以有效提升区块更新时间的响应速度:
提高区块容量
- 尝试减少新区块大小,以降低矿工工作量,加快确认速度。
减少智能合约执行延迟
- 对智能合约代码进行优化,避免冗余操作和异常条件导致的延迟。
- 使用更高效的编程语言或工具来编写智能合约。
引入分片技术
- 分片技术允许同时处理多个新区块,从而显著缩短整体确认时间。
调整共识算法
- 探索不同的共识算法,如DPoS、PBFT等,看是否能在保证安全性的前提下提升确认速度。
通过上述措施,可以有效地优化以太坊区块更新时间,为用户提供更加流畅和高效的服务体验。
版权声明:文章版权声明: 币闻社所有区块链相关数据与资料仅供用户学习及研究之用,不构成任何投资、法律等其他领域的建议和依据。强烈建议您独自对内容进行研究、审查、分析和验证,谨慎使用相关数据及内容,并自行承担所带来的一切风险。